Description

The STEVAL-DPSTPFC2 kit is a 1 kW power factor correction (PFC) converter based on bridgeless totem-pole topology, operating in continuous conduction mode (CCM) and designed to address high efficiency and power density.The solution is based on gallium nitride (GaN) technology SGT080R70ILB, and the advantage of negligible reverse recovery losses makes it ideal in this kind of applications where CCM mode is required.The low frequency leg in this topology is realized using Si MOSFET ST8L65N044M9 instead of using diodes, reducing conduction losses.The STEVAL-DPSTPFC2 kit regulates a constant output bus voltage both at 115 and 230 Vrms, reaching a peak efficiency of nearly 99%.The control algorithm is implemented using the vertically pluggable control board, STEVAL-DPS334C1.The gate drivers used, STGAP2GSN and STGAP2D ensure reliable driving for the GaN and Si MOSFET respectively also providing galvanic isolation.

Features

Nearly 99% peak efficiencyInput voltage range: 90 to 264 VacLine frequency range: 47 to 63 HzMaximum output power: 1 kW at 230 Vac, 500 W at 115 VacNominal output voltage: 400 VdcPower factor: > 0.98 at 230 Vac, > 0.99 at 115 Vac, full loadTotal harmonic distortion (THDi): < 4% at 115 Vac, < 5% at 230 Vac, full loadSwitching frequency: 70 kHzPower stage based on SGT080R70ILB PowerGaN and ST8L65N044M9 MDmesh M9 Power MOSFETControl system based on 2p2z regulators
